Politics & Prose Will Open New Location Near Union Market

Politics & Prose, the upper Northwest DC bookstore that opened its doors back in 1984, will open a new location in Northeast DC this fall.
The bookstore announced this morning that the new store will open near Union Market, but did not specify the store’s exact location.

“The new P&P branch will be smaller than P&P’s main store on Connecticut Avenue NW but big enough to carry a wide range of books and non-book items,” a press release stated. “Additionally, with a presence in Union Market, P&P will be well-positioned to host author events in the area, creating a new, metro-accessible destination for people interested in meeting writers, enjoying books, and engaging in conversation.”
The release goes on to say that there will be event space attached to the store and that it will use the Dock 5 event space attached to Union Market for larger events and readings.
While it is unclear which new development the store will be located in, there are many to choose from.
